Transaction 6b523ee61ea88fc25c5f5bb8c243b625e811ea772db2d2fdda1396a8d0b29fc9
1 Input
1 Output
-
6b523ee61ea88fc25c5f5bb8c243b625e811ea772db2d2fdda1396a8d0b29fc9:0
- value
- 668149790
- script pubkey
- OP_0 OP_PUSHBYTES_32 4b5ec8b742c5d9f76ef016ceb26c0d04510970738d219dea3e0bbeb07d3080ad
- address
- bc1qfd0v3d6zchvlwmhszm8tymqdq3gsjurn35sem637pwltqlfsszks43gyuz